
Recent security updates from Microdaft have depreciated an older driver certificate signing method that prevents older drivers from being trusted and used.
This “feature” has broken thousands of fully functional pieces of hardware and assigned them to the E-waste scrap heap.
Luckily there is a solution for us.
This fix does not make or need any changes to windows security as it is just updated drivers.
Download and run this update (Once downloaded, Right click and run as administrator), and it will be fixed. Your browser may want to block it’s download, your Antivirus might want to eat it. it is not a virus. It is not dangerous. See very bottom of this page for how to deal with it.
This update requires that the the old driver package is already installed, so if you have been messing about trying to fix it, you may need to reinstall the older package.

FYI YOU DO NOT HAVE TO PLUG THE CABLE IN DURING INSTALLATION AT ALL
Once you have a working Vida / VDASH installation , quit Vida / VDASH, then download and run the Driver package relevant to your operating system from the links below .
x86 for 32bit Windows or x64 for 64bit Windows (most are 64bit these days)
(Follow this link if you do not know if you are 32 or 64 bit)
32bit windows is also known as x86 , 64bit windows is also known as x64
When it starts installing click next, accept the license terms and hit next, then next, then install, then ok, then Finish.
Then install the Update as mentioned above
Now when you start Vida, on the Vehicle profile tab, under the Communication tool, you will now see Mongoose Pro JLR, choose this and proceed as normal.
